PH Value of Foods - Fruits All
Fruits | pH |
Apples | |
Delicious | 3.9 |
Golden Delicious | 3.6 |
Jonathan | 3.33 |
McIntosh | 3.34 |
Winesap | 3.47 |
Juice | 3.4 - 4.0 |
Sauce | 3.3 - 3.6 |
Apricots | 3.3 - 4.0 |
Dried | 3.6 - 4.0 |
Canned | 3.74 |
Bananas | 4.5 - 5.2 |
Cantaloupe | 6.17-7.13 |
Dates | 6.3 - 6.6 |
Figs | 4.6 |
Grapefruit | 3.0 - 3.3 |
Canned | 3.1 - 3.3 |
Juice | 3 |
Lemons | 2.2 - 2.4 |
Canned juice | 2.3 |
Limes | 1.8 - 2.0 |
Mangos | 3.9 - 4.6 |
Melons | |
Casaba | 5.5 - 6.0 |
Honey dew | 6.3 - 6.7 |
Persian | 6.0 - 6.3 |
Nectarines | 3.9 |
Oranges | 3.1 - 4.1 |
Juice | 3.6 - 4.3 |
Marmalade | 3 |
Papaya | 5.2 - 5.7 |
Peaches | 3.4 - 3.6 |
In jars | 4.2 |
In cans | 4.9 |
Persimmons | 5.4 - 5.8 |
Pineapple | 3.3 - 5.2 |
Canned | 3.5 |
Juice | 3.5 |
Plums | 2.8 - 4.6 |
Pomegranates | 3 |
Prunes | 3.1 - 5.4 |
Juice | 3.7 |
Quince (stewed) | 3.1 - 3.3 |
Tangerines | 4 |
Watermelon | 5.2 - 5.8 |
BERRIES | pH |
Blackberries | 3.2 - 4.5 |
Blueberries | 3.7 |
Frozen | 3.1 - 3.35 |
Cherries | 3.2 - 4.1 |
Cranberries | |
Sauce | 2.4 |
Juice | 2.3 - 2.5 |
Currants (red) | 2.9 |
Gooseberries | 2.8 - 3.1 |
Grapes | 3.4 - 4.5 |
Raspberries | 3.2 - 3.7 |
Strawberries | 3.0 - 3.5 |
